Colorado Springs, CO services ## The Heartbeat: Machines That Never Sleep At the core of PinkyBot is the heartbeat system — a cron job that fires every 15 minutes and wakes up the entire bot army. Every heartbeat, the platform reads your current priorities, picks up pending tasks, routes them to the right specialized bot, executes them, and commits results to a rolling handoff document that tracks everything in a filing cabinet system. This is literal automation. The bots read files, write code, make API calls, post content, scan wallets, and generate reports — all without you typing a single command. Every task gets a tracking number in the format PB-BOT-YYYYMMDD-NNNN. Every action is logged. Every completed task is committed with full chain of custody. The heartbeat interval scales with your plan. Starter tier users get a 4-hour heartbeat. Pro tier gets 1 hour. Business tier and above get the full 15-minute pulse. AnalyticsBot provides four data panels: User Growth, Bot Performance, Revenue (Stripe integration showing MRR, new subscriptions, churn), and System Health. ## CityForge: Local SEO at Machine Speed Here's the reality for service businesses in Colorado Springs: if you're serving the Pikes Peak Region, you need landing pages for Briargate, Peregrine, Cordera, Broadmoor, Old North End, Old Colorado City, Patty Jewett, East Colorado Springs, Powers Corridor, Northgate, Cimarron Hills, and dozens of other neighborhoods. Each one has distinct demographics, competitor landscapes, local search behavior, and cultural character. Manually writing 50 pages with real local data takes months. With CityForge, it takes one session. The pipeline works in five stages. **Stage One: City Selection.** An interactive SVG map of the United States lets you click cities or select them in bulk. You can target the entire Pikes Peak Region or zero in on specific neighborhoods. The database covers 500+ cities organized by tier, so you can strategically target high-value areas or go broad. **Stage Two: Research.** CityForge calls Perplexity Sonar Pro with custom research prompts designed to extract real local data. For Briargate, it researches Lockheed Martin's presence, the Promenade Shops corridor, top schools in Academy District 20, and the neighborhood's character as a modern master-planned community. For Old Colorado City, it pulls the Gold Rush heritage, current art gallery scene, First Friday traditions, and proximity to Garden of the Gods. For Powers Corridor, it researches UCHealth Park, the brewery and restaurant scene, Palmer Park trail access, and why young professionals are moving to the area. This isn't generic filler — every page is genuinely different from the next. **Stage Three: Content Generation.** Using the research data, CityForge generates full HTML landing pages with your branding, services, and contact information woven through city-specific content. Pages include proper H1/H2 structure, meta title, meta description, canonical URL, FAQ schema markup, LocalBusiness schema, keyword-optimized body copy, and 16+ calls to action. The platform tracks duplicate openers across pages to keep language varied. A quality validator checks word count, scans for AI phrase patterns, and verifies structural elements before marking a page ready. **Stage Four: Review.** The review modal shows a full-page preview on the left and feedback controls on the right. Approve as-is, reject, or submit specific revision instructions. The AI rewrites the page and the preview refreshes instantly. When satisfied, you approve and the page moves to the deploy queue. **Stage Five: Deployment.** CityForge supports three deploy methods. The WordPress SSH deploy uses SFTP to upload pages directly to your WordPress site — the system reads your active theme, generates a PHP router that wraps the city content in your site's header and footer, creates proper breadcrumb navigation (Home > Services > City Name), and automatically handles directory structure including an images/ subdirectory. Standard SSH deploy uploads raw HTML files to any web server. ZIP download bundles everything for manual upload. Image handling is fully automated. When a Pexels or Unsplash API key is configured, CityForge automatically populates each page with relevant stock photography. If no stock photo key is configured, the platform warns you immediately on panel load. After deployment, CityForge generates a complete sitemap.xml covering all deployed city pages plus your main site pages, ready for Google Search Console submission. PinkyBot is built with that same obsession. Data isolation runs four tiers deep. Platform admin has cross-user visibility. Workspace admins can only see their own workspace data. Regular users see only their own data. Public routes require no authentication. Every API route must be explicitly registered in a whitelist firewall. The default behavior for any unregistered route is to return 403. This means new features must consciously be added to the allowed list — accidental exposure is not possible. Tier gating is enforced at both backend and frontend. The backend is authoritative. Pre-commit hooks run five checks on every deployment: JavaScript syntax validation, sidebar button count verification, protected file blocks, behind-master verification, and file deletion prevention. If something is broken, it doesn't ship. What happens if a bot task fails? Who gets notified?

TasksBot enforces a two-failure rule. If a task fails once, it retries automatically. If it fails a second time, it stops and escalates to human review. This prevents infinite retry loops that waste tokens and cloud compute cost. You'll see the failed task in your dashboard with full details about what went wrong, where it failed, and what instructions to give the bot to fix it. Every task gets a tracking number (PB-BOT-YYYYMMDD-NNNN) and a full chain of custody log, so you can always see what the bots have done and what still needs human attention.
